Megan Thee Stallion arrives at the premiere of" Megan Thee Stallion : In Her Words" on Wednesday, Oct. 30, 2024, at TCL Chinese Theatre in Los Angeles.“A lot of people were trying to take control of my narrative and tell my story, so that’s why I even agreed to do the documentary in the first place.”Speaking in front of a packed crowd at Los Angeles’ TCL Chinese Theatre on Wednesday, Megan Thee Stallion made her biographical vision clear.

“Megan Thee Stallion: In Her Words,” a memoir-style documentary directed by Nneka Onuorah, offers what its Amazon MGM Studios description calls “unprecedented access” to the multifaceted Houston native, who hustled to reach hip-hop success in just a few years after her rapper momager, the late Holly “Holly-Wood” Thomas, planted the seed during her childhood. Megan Thee Stallion unpacks her journey to stardom while navigating fame, grief and success in Prime Video's"Megan Thee Stallion: In Her Words."Artist documentaries involving the artist can easily become vanity projects that gloss over nuance, but this documentary feels like an exception. Whose idea was it to be so candid and transparent in telling Megan’s story?Well, I think we both wanted to be candid and transparent in this film. That’s what we made it for.
